Burger Pollo Menonita, American restaurant in Nuevo Ideal, Mexico.
Burger Pollo Menonita is a restaurant along Carretera Francisco Zarco that serves burgers, pizza, ice cream, and cheese dishes. The kitchen remains open throughout the day for local residents and travelers passing through.
The restaurant reflects the strong presence of Mennonite settlers in the Nuevo Ideal region, who brought their culinary traditions to northern Mexico. This settlement shaped local food culture over many years.
The restaurant blends American burger traditions with Mennonite cooking methods that have been practiced in this region for generations. This mix shows itself in how local ingredients and handcrafted techniques appear in the dishes.
